| Feature | Base Game (Switch) | Ultimate NSPDL (w/ DLC & Updates) |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| | Base version 1.0 or earlier. | Latest version, bundled with all content. | | Worlds & Enemies | 4 Prime Worlds with standard enemies. | 4 Prime Worlds + 4 Altered Worlds. Dozens of new enemy variants. | | Bosses | Standard set of bosses (e.g., Praxis). | +4 new bosses, +4 new mini-bosses, and the new True Architect fight. | | Weapons & Skills | Core set of weapons and skills. | +2 weapons (Hyper Gloves & Ember Buster) and +9 skills. | | Game Modes | Standard roguelite runs. | +Daily Dungeons, Boss Rush, Chaos Run. | | Replayability | High, but limited by base content. | Significantly increased by DLC content, new modes, and curses. | | Performance | Prone to lag, especially in co-op. | Performance improvements likely incorporated via updates. | | Price (Estimated USD) | $24.99 | Unauthorized distribution is piracy.
